Regular Season Round 8: Shandong GS - Xinjiang FT 111-118
Date: November 6, 2018
Everything could happen in Jinan at the game between two tied teams. Both eighth ranked Xinjiang Flying Tige and 10th ranked Golden Stars had identical 4-3 record. But Golden Stars were not able to use a home court advantage and were defeated by the opponent from Urumqi 118-111 on Tuesday night. Xinjiang Flying Tige made 33-of-39 free shots (84.6 percent) during the game, while Golden Stars only scored twelve points from the stripe. Xinjiang Flying Tige looked well-organized offensively handing out 22 assists. Golden Stars were plagued by 30 personal fouls down the stretch. Worth to mention a great performance of American-Bulgarian point guard Darius Adams (188-89, college: Indianapolis, agency: IPZ) who helped to win the game recording a double-double by scoring 48 points (!!!), 10 rebounds, 8 assists and 6 steals and international Abudushalamu Abudurexiti (203-96) who added 14 points and 9 rebounds during the contest. Five Xinjiang Flying Tige players scored in double figures. Lithuanian power forward Donatas Motiejunas (213-90) responded with a double-double by scoring 35 points (!!!), 16 rebounds and 6 assists and American guard Andrew Goudelock (190-88, college: Charleston) scored 32 points, 6 rebounds and 5 assists. Both coaches allowed to play bench players saving starting five for next games. Xinjiang Flying Tige (5-3) moved-up to sixth place, which they share with Guangzhou LL and Shenzhen L. Loser Golden Stars dropped to the ninth position with four games lost. Xinjiang Flying Tige will face Blue Whales (#15) in Sichuan in the next round and are hoping to win another game. Golden Stars will play at home against Jiangsu Dragons (#9) and it may be a tough game between close rivals.
